SPIN is a comprehensive service that provides authorized investigators with the most current information on available funding opportunities (both national and international) for projects. SPIN is not just limited to scientific opportunities; there are listings for other disciplines including education and social work, among others. SPIN consists of two modules:

SPIN (Sponsored Programs Information Network) — An up-to-date listing of funding opportunities from national and international governmental and private funding sources.

  • SPIN can be accessed by logging in to PennERA and clicking the Find Funding link on your landing page. 

SMARTS (SPIN Matching and Research Transmittal Service) — A system that matches user profiles with the SPIN funding opportunities and automatically delivers daily updates via e-mail.

  • SMARTS can be accessed by logging into PennERA > My Profile > SMARTS.
